![]() "Dave Hyde" wrote in message ... Anyone got any suggestions on how to pre-oil a Lyc. O-320 before its first run? If it's the first run after overhaul, then the assembly lube should do its job. If it's new and has already been test run, then it's the lifter faces and cam that might be dry. I think you're 'sposed to get it up to splash speed immediately after starting to minimize the scuffing. There's probably a good recommendation at the Sacramento Sky Ranch site. Wayne |
